Trace: » site_index » new_page » thursday_may_7 » friday_may_7 » see_pictures_here » molecular_biology_discovery_workshop » manuals_and_brochures » top_tips » explain » protocols
Table of Contents
Trace: » site_index » new_page » thursday_may_7 » friday_may_7 » see_pictures_here » molecular_biology_discovery_workshop » manuals_and_brochures » top_tips » explain » protocols